What is Secondary Glazing?
Secondary glazing involves the installation of an extra pane of glass or acrylic to existing windows. This produces an insulating air gap that helps in reducing heat loss and noise seepage. Unlike traditional double glazing, which has 2 sheets of glass, Secondary Glazing Durable Materials glazing can be contributed to single-pane windows, permitting property owners to improve their existing windows without total replacement.
How Secondary Glazing Works
Secondary glazing develops a barrier between the exterior and interior environments. The key mechanisms at work consist of:
Insulation: The air gap between the panes forms an insulating layer, significantly minimizing heat transfer through conduction.Minimized Thermal Bridging: Secondary glazing minimizes the transfer of heat through the window frames, guaranteeing more stable indoor temperatures.Sound Dampening: The additional layer also serves as a sound barrier, reducing sound pollution from outdoors.Efficiency of Secondary Glazing
To better understand the efficiency of secondary glazing, let's take a look at some quantifiable factors and compare them to traditional single-glazed windows.
FactorSingle GlazingSecondary GlazingDouble GlazingU-Value (W/m ² K)5.0 - 6.01.5 - 2.01.0 - 1.4Sound Reduction (dB)25 - 3030 - 4535 - 45Installation CostLowMediumHighRoiN/A5-10 years10-20 years
The table above shows the various elements of primary glazing systems. Significantly, secondary glazing considerably improves the U-value, which measures thermal insulation-- the lower the U-value, the better the insulation.
Advantages of Secondary GlazingEnergy Efficiency: Secondary Glazing Benefits glazing boosts thermal insulation, causing decreased heating and cooling costs.Cost-Effectiveness: Compared to complete window replacements, Secondary Glazing Specialists glazing is a more affordable route to enhancing energy efficiency.Noise Reduction: Particularly helpful for homes in urban environments, secondary glazing provides significant sound proofing.Historical Preservation: Perfect for listed structures or duration homes where original windows should be retained, secondary glazing provides a discreet way to improve performance.Easy Installation: Generally, secondary glazing can be fitted without substantial changes, making it a less invasive alternative compared to replacing whole windows.Disadvantages of Secondary GlazingCondensation Issues: Without appropriate ventilation, the air gap may collect condensation, possibly leading to mold issues.Less Effective for Extreme Climates: In extremely cold or hot environments, secondary glazing alone may not suffice without extra insulation procedures.Look: Depending on the design and materials utilized, secondary glazing can change the aesthetic of windows, which may not be desirable for all property owners.How to Achieve Maximum Efficiency with Secondary Glazing
To optimize the benefits of secondary glazing, consider the following tips:
Choose High-Quality Materials: Opt for low-emissivity glass or acrylic, which reflects heat and increases thermal efficiency.Make Sure Proper Sealing: Installing your secondary glazing with top quality seals is vital to preventing air leak.Routine Maintenance: Clean and check seals regularly to guarantee maximum efficiency and longevity.Think About Window Treatments: Complement secondary glazing with drapes or thermal blinds for included insulation.Frequently Asked Question About Secondary Glazing Efficiency
1. How much does secondary glazing cost?secondary Glazing efficiency glazing costs vary depending upon the materials utilized and the complexity of installation. Typically, house owners may expect to spend between ₤ 300 to ₤ 600 per window.

2. Is secondary glazing efficient for noise reduction?Yes, secondary glazing can significantly minimize noise transmission, making it perfect for homes found near busy roadways or in loud city locations.

3. Can secondary glazing be utilized on any window?In many cases, secondary glazing can be adapted to various window styles. Nevertheless, it's constantly best to talk to a professional installer for customized advice.

4. Does secondary glazing need planning permission?Particular policies can differ based on local laws and the age of the home. If you live in a noted building or sanctuary, you may need to consult your Local Secondary Glazing planning authority.
